
The Red Bento is a series of Asian-fusion restaurants located in the Palouse / Lewis-Clark area. With a large menu comprising of Japanese meals (Sushi, Teriyaki, Yakisoba, Tempura) and Asian-fusion offerings (Korean, Chinese, Thai), the restaurant would go on to be a massive success with the local community, and be voted the "Best Asian Restaurant" in the Palouse for four years straight by Pullman Daily News.
Following the Moscow restaurant's success, a new Pullman location would open three years later, in the summer of 2012. Located on Stadium Way, the Red Bento became the primary source of quality Asian meals in the Pullman area. The success of both Moscow and Pullman locations gave way for yet another location to open-- this time, in Lewiston Idaho.
